苹果签名和苹果上架是苹果应用程序开发者必须了解的两个概念。这两个概念都是苹果公司为了保护用户安全和保证应用程序质量而推出的措施。
苹果签名是指对应用程序进行数字签名,以确保应用程序的完整性和真实性。苹果签名的原理是使用非对称加密算法,即使用私钥对应用程序进行数字签名,然后使用公钥进行验证。若验证通过,则证明该应用程序是由开发者签名并未被篡改的。
苹果上架是指将应用程序提交到苹果官方的App Store进行审核并发布的过程。在提交应用程序之前,开发者必须确保应用程序已经进行了苹果签名。苹果上架的审核过程非常严格,苹果公司会对应用程序进行全面的安全和质量审核,以确保用户的安全和应用程序的质量。如果应用程序通过了审核,就会被发布到苹果官方的App Store上。
苹果签名和苹果上架的作用非常重要。苹果签名可以防止应用程序被篡改,保证用户安全;苹果上架可以保证应用程序的质量和安全性,为用户提供优质的应用程序选择。同时,苹果签名和苹果上架也为开发者提供了更好的应用程序分发和推广渠道。
总之,苹果签名和苹果上架是苹果应用程序开发者必须了解的两个概念。开发者应该在开发应用程序的过程中,充分了解并遵守苹果公司的相关规定和要求,以确保应用程序的质量和安全性。